Meaning, origin, history
Cambryn is a unique and intriguing given name of Welsh origin. It is derived from the Welsh word "cambr" which means "crooked" or "bent". The name Cambryn is believed to have originated as an occupational surname for someone who lived near a bend in a river or road.
The earliest record of the name Cambryn can be traced back to the 16th century in Wales. However, it was not until the late 20th century that the name began to be used as a given name. Today, Cambryn is considered a unisex name, but it is still quite rare and unique.
Despite its unconventional origin, the name Cambryn has a certain charm and character to it. It is a name that stands out and makes a strong impression. Its Welsh heritage adds an air of authenticity and uniqueness to the name.
In terms of popularity, Cambryn is not a common name. According to data from the Social Security Administration in the United States, there were only 5 girls named Cambryn born in 2019, making it one of the least popular names that year. However, this rarity could also be seen as an advantage for those who wish to give their child a distinctive and memorable name.
